.layout-boxed .body-innerwrapper {
    max-width: 873px;
    box-shadow: none;
}
p{
    font-size: 13px!important;
}
.row,
.container{
    padding: 0!important;
    margin: 0!important;
}
#sp-menu li a {
    font-family: Tahoma;
    font-size: 11px;
    float: left;
    display: block;
    line-height: 58px;
    padding: 0 24px 0 16px;
    color: #C1C5C8;
    text-decoration: none;
    font-weight: bold;
    text-transform: uppercase;
}
#sp-menu li {
    margin: 0;
    padding: 0;
    height: 58px;
    background: url(../images/menu_li.jpg) top right no-repeat;
}
#sp-menu {
    text-align: center;
    margin: 0 auto;
    padding: 0;
    background: url(../images/menu.jpg) top center no-repeat;
    width: 873px;
    height: 58px;
    padding-right: 40px;
}
body {
    padding: 0;
    background: #353D40;
}
#sp-top1,
#sp-top1 p{
    padding: 0!important;
    margin: 0;
}
#sp-left .sp-module{
    padding: 0;
    border: 0;
}
#sp-left {
    background: #2F3739;
}
#sp-left h3 {
    color: #BEC4C4!important;
    font-family: Tahoma!important;
    font-size: 13px!important;
    text-align: center!important;
    height: 44px!important;
    text-decoration: none!important;
    text-transform: uppercase!important;
    padding: 0!important;
    font-weight: bold!important;
    line-height: 44px!important;
    margin: 0!important;
    border-bottom: 0!important;
}
.switcher {
    margin: 0 auto;
}
main#sp-component {
    background: #353d40;
    color: rgb(192,192,192);
}
main#sp-component p{
    font-size: 13px!important;
}
.article-details .article-header h1, 
.article-details .article-header h2{
    font-size: 16px!important;
    margin: 10px 0;
}
#sp-footer1 {
    margin: 0 auto;
    width: 873px;
    height: 74px;
    text-align: center;
    vertical-align: top;
    padding-bottom: 10px;
    background: url(../images/bg_footer.jpg) repeat-x left top;
    overflow: hidden;
    color: #fff;
}
#sp-footer1 a{
    color: #fff;
    text-decoration: underline;
}
.contact dt{
    display: inline;
}
span.jicons-icons img {
    display: inline;
}